I had heard this story when I was a kid.
There was a school in a small village. The students who were studying there were poor. Rachana was teaching in the school. Suresh was a 5 year old boy in her class.
One day Rachana took her class to the beach. Suresh and his friends started to play on the beach. Suresh found a shell. He started telling his friends that he has found a pearl and that he will sell it and become rich. When Rachana saw him telling this, she told him that the chance of pearl in that shell is very low.
Suresh showed the shell to his grandfather and told him that he has found a pearl. The old man smiled to him and said indeed you have found a pearl. Suresh became very happy and went to play.
Rachana was a realistic person. She confronted the old man and said that the chance of the shell having a pearl is one in a million so why is he raising the hope of the small boy. The old man replied that, indeed the chance of having pearl in the shell were very low, but it was not zero. Sometimes, there are only hopes that a person can live by; and the hopes need not be broken before time.
Whenever I get into a situation that looks difficult and outcome are dim, I am reminded of this story.
How true that Sometimes there are only hopes that a person can live by.
